San Jose (California) [USA], January 20, 2024: Samsung, the South Korean smartphone manufacturer, debuted its highly anticipated Galaxy S24 Ultra, Galaxy S24+, and Galaxy S24 on Wednesday.

Interestingly, at the Galaxy Unpacked 2024 event, the tech giant introduced its next flagship smartphones with Galaxy AI, a full set of AI-powered capabilities that boost communication, creativity, searchability, and performance.

According to Mashable, AI-powered features will enable users to dump third-party apps in favor of beneficial tools such as Live Translate, which allows you to translate languages in real time via phone conversations or texts.

Other Galaxy AI features that may aid users are the following:

Chat Assist - Adjusts the tone of your messages to ensure they are suitable for work, social media, or anywhere you desire to share them.

Note Assist - Make summaries of your notes or utilise pre-made templates to urge you to write.

Circle to Search - Circle, highlight, scribble, or tap on anything to receive meaningful, high-quality search results.

Google has cooperated with Samsung on AI for the latter's next flagship products.

Sunder Pichai, Google CEO, revealed the 'Circle to Search' feature on X, adding, "We continue to apply AI to make Search more helpful and intuitive. Building on features like Lens, and Circle to Search is our next key accomplishment, allowing you to search what you see on @Android phones with a single gesture without switching apps. #SamsungUnpacked."

"The Galaxy S24 series transforms our global connectivity and lays the foundation for the next decade of mobile innovation." Galaxy AI is built on our innovation legacy and a detailed understanding of how people use their devices. We're happy to witness how our users around the world use Galaxy AI to enhance their daily lives and open up new possibilities," said TM Roh, President, and Head of Mobile eXperience (MX) Business at Samsung Electronics.

AI features have a big impact on the camera app, particularly in terms of offering potential editing improvements.

This year's new features include the ProVisual Engine and a dedicated ISP Block for noise reduction. The ProVision Engine is a set of AI-powered applications, such as Generative Edit, which allows you to erase things and have AI fill in the space.

It can also fill in the space left by straightening a crooked shot. According to GSMArena, Instant Slow-mo may generate additional frames to smoothly slow down particular points in the video.




3 January 2024: In their annual reports, Indian banks have employed an extensive array of terminology and concepts relating to AI and Machine learning.

According to the Reserve Bank of India's banking and trends report, the use of AI-related terms in Indian banks has expanded significantly, particularly in private sector banks. However, adoption among public sector banks has been somewhat subdued, rising approximately 2.5 times throughout the study period.

The chatbots are usually accessible through the banks' websites. In the case of PSBs, mega-mergers appear to have boosted chatbot adoption, with combined organisations embracing acquirers' technology. A word cloud analysis highlights banks' emphasis on automation, which may be motivated by the desire to increase efficiency while also improving fraud detection and other predictive analytics.

"AI is increasingly being used in areas such as asset management, algorithmic trading, credit underwriting, and blockchain-based financial services," the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) stated in its publications. According to the top banks' study, AI will alter the financial services sector by encouraging the development of new goods and services, opening up new markets and industries, and paving the path for innovation.

AI and ML Lingo in Banks

According to a recent survey, over one-third of responding financial services, organisations expect AI technology to assist 51 to 75 percent of their workload in five years. The same is being done by Indian banks, whether private or public sector.

According to the RBI investigation, practically every bank in India is utilising popular AI and ML dictionaries/glossaries such as Google Vertex AI, Google Developers, IBM, NHS AI Lab, the Council of Europe, and Large Language Models such as ChatGPT and Bard. Chatbots for customer support are also being introduced by NBFCs.

Indian banks have employed an extensive variety of AI and Machine Learning terminology and concepts. Chatbots, Artificial Intelligence, Cloud Computing, Machine Learning, Customer Segmentation, data analytics, robotics support automation, the Internet of Things, and many other technologies are part of the world.

ICICI Bank used the term Artificial Intelligence six times in its FY23 annual report, Machine Learning four times, Cloud Adoption and Computing nine times, and Data Analytics five times. The bank used Machine Learning five times, Artificial Intelligence ten times, Cloud 25 times, and Data Analytics three times in its FY23 Annual Report. State Bank of India, India's largest public sector bank, used AI three times, Machine Learning twice, and Data Analytics only once.

According to RBI research conducted in 2016-2017, the number of banks utilising chatbots was five, which increased to ten in FY18. From ten in FY18 to twelve in FY23, the number of banks with chatbots increased to nearly twenty-six in FY23.

Gemini is a multimodal model that can effortlessly comprehend and combine many sorts of information, including text, code, voice, image, and video, according to Demis Hassabis, CEO and Co-Founder of Google DeepMind.

Gemini is unique in that it is natively multimodal, meaning that different modalities don't require separate components to be sewn together. This innovative strategy, refined through extensive cross-team collaboration across Google teams, presents Gemini as a versatile and effective model that can operate on everything from mobile devices to data centers. Gemini's powerful multimodal reasoning, which allows it to precisely extract insights from large datasets, is one of its most notable qualities. The model is also capable of comprehending and producing well-written code in widely used programming languages.

But even as Google steps into this new AI era, accountability and security are still top priorities. Gemini is subjected to thorough safety reviews, which include toxicity and bias analyses. Google is aggressively working with outside specialists to resolve any potential blind spots and guarantee the moral use of the model.

The Bard chatbot is among the Google products that Gemini 1.0 is now being rolled out. There are plans to integrate Gemini 1.0 with Search, Ads, Chrome, and Duet AI. Nevertheless, the Bard update won't be made available in Europe unless regulators give its approval.

Gemini Pro is available to developers and enterprise users through Google Cloud Vertex AI or Google AI Studio's Gemini API. using Android 14, a new system feature called AICore will enable Android developers to create using Gemini Nano.
